Annihilate by MASS PANIC is a bass-heavy Dubstep track at 150 BPM with moderate drive and strong groove. At 58% energy, it works as an energy builder — pushing the floor forward without peaking.

150 BPM — squarely in dubstep territory, mixable within roughly 145–155 BPM without pitch artefacts.
A Minor — 8A on the Camelot wheel. Harmonically compatible with 8B, 7A and 9A.
Tracks in 8A, 8B, 7A or 9A between ~145–155 BPM.
Mid-set energy builder — 58% energy with strong groove pushes the floor forward without peaking. Save peak-time slots for higher-drive records.
